How to Find a Therapist That’s Right for You! With Cheryl Chisholm

Listen to Cheryl’s Advice on First Wednesday: Conversations with Byllye and Ngina Wednesday, June 2, 2 p.m. EST

Last month, Byllye and Ngina led a thought-provoking discussion on Black women and depression. This month, they are bringing you expert advice on how to find the right therapist.

Cheryl Chisholm, licensed therapist and director of the Imperative-produced documentary, “On Becoming a Woman: Mothers and Daughters Talking Together,” will join Byllye and Ngina on our BlogTalkRadio show “First Wednesday” on Wednesday, June 2 at 2 p.m. EST.

On Wednesday, June 2, Cheryl will provide unique insight into an issue rarely discussed among Black women – seeking professional help for the emotional and mental health challenges that many of us are facing.
